After the brand started off their products in muted hues, Bold Cycles now brings on the color. With an all new womens specific model, the swiss brand launches a limited edition All-Mountain bike. All information can be found in the official Press Release:

In cooperation with the Women´s Bike Camp and the Bold factory rider Sabrina Morell, the „Linkin Trail WBC Edition“ was developed and limited up to 30 bikes. When it comes to geometry and cinematics, the bike reverts to the award winning Linkin Trail specified for the female rider. Suspension wise the Rockshocks Pike RCT3 leads to a maximum of grip in the front, while a DT Swiss shock offers 130mm of rear travel. With Ergon-grips and the Terry Arteria saddle the bike is equiped with women-specific parts. In terms of drivetrains there is a joice between Shimano´s XT 2×11 and Sram´s GX groupset. All the other parts are either Raceface Next or Turbine and therefore strong but lightweight. In line with the Bold philosphy there is a joice between 29“ wheels or 27,5plus. The bikes can now be ordered/reserved through the webshop or a an authorized Bold-dealer. Available from May.

We’ve already reviewed the Bold Linkin Trail Race Day and the Linkin Trail Sick Day won the highly sought after Design & Innovation Award 2016. Furthermore Bold Cycles was elected the Newcomer of the Year at the Design & Innovation Award 2016.

Prices

Linkin Trail WBC Edition XT: 4780€
Linkin Trail WBC Edition GX: 4684€

You can order the bike with 29″ or B+ Tyres.
